The Wolfos is an enemy that appears in Ocarina of Time and Majora's Mask.
Appearances
Ocarina of Time
Wolfos |
In Ocarina of Time, Wolfos are not a very common enemy and they only appear three times. They are found in the Sacred Forest Meadow, the Forest Temple, and in the Gerudo Training Ground. To defeat the Wolfos, Link needs to dodge their attacks until they spin around, giving Link a chance to defeat them with a Jump Attack to the back. Hitting either the White Wolfos or the regular Wolfos in the back instantaneously defeats them.
Another version of the Wolfos known as the White Wolfos appears in cold environments.
Majora's Mask

In Majora's Mask, Wolfos look and act the same as the Wolfos from Ocarina of Time. They are located on the path between Termina Field and Woodfall at night. After Link defeats Goht and returns Snowhead to spring, they will spawn where the White Wolfos were during Winter. They also appear as targets in the Swamp Shooting Gallery.
